Allow binding event handlers to individual Creatures.
Because GUIDs are, in fact, not globally unique on mangos, the actual unique identifier is the GUID/instance ID pair of the Creature. On Trinity Creatures in instances are assigned new GUIDs. This means that the instance ID part is redundant but must be used anyway for consistency.
